Why won't scan disk run even in safe mode? It freezes just after starting up. Sometimes the computer does not detect the hard drive and so I have to go into setup and autodetect to boot up. Is this due to data error or physical damage to the hard drive?

Try running scan disk through your win98 startup disk If that doesn't work it could be that one of your plate in your hard drive is damage, if that is the case you can send it back to the people that made it
